How do you eggshell fertilizer?
Here are the steps on how to make eggshell fertilizer:
1. Collect eggshells. Save eggshells from your kitchen scraps. Rinse them thoroughly to remove any egg residue and let them dry completely.
2. Grind the eggshells into a fine powder. You can use a coffee grinder, blender, or mortar and pestle to grind the eggshells into a fine powder.
3. Mix the eggshell powder with water. Mix the eggshell powder with water in a ratio of 1:1. For example, if you have 1 cup of eggshell powder, mix it with 1 cup of water.
4. Let the mixture sit for 24 hours. Stir the mixture occasionally during this time.
5. Strain the mixture. After 24 hours, strain the mixture through a cheesecloth or fine mesh strainer to remove any solids.
6. Dilute the eggshell fertilizer. Dilute the eggshell fertilizer with water at a ratio of 1:10. For example, if you have 1 cup of eggshell fertilizer, mix it with 10 cups of water.
7. Apply the eggshell fertilizer to your plants. Water your plants with the eggshell fertilizer once a month.
Benefits of eggshell fertilizer:
* Eggshell fertilizer is a natural source of calcium, which is essential for plant growth.
* Eggshell fertilizer helps to improve the soil structure and drainage.
* Eggshell fertilizer is a slow-release fertilizer, which means that it will provide nutrients to your plants over a long period of time.
* Eggshell fertilizer is a cost-effective way to fertilize your plants.
